Red flags on quotes
Verbal-only pricing, deposits above 20%, cash-only discounts, and unwillingness to itemise materials by brand are the top four. Any one is a pass.
What a defensible quote looks like
Written scope with photos, itemised labour + materials, 30-day validity, WSIB and liability certificate attached, and named workmanship warranty (5 years is the current bar for winter prep).
Vetting a Barrie contractor
Three checks that filter 90% of problems: (1) live WSIB clearance certificate, (2) named directors matching corporate filings, (3) two Barrie references from the last 12 months you can call — not read.

Do you need a permit for winter prep in Barrie?
Cleaning and inspection are permit-exempt in Barrie. Structural masonry, liner replacement, or a new appliance install typically need one — we pull it as part of the job when required.
